Roboteon Launches Unified Orchestration Software for Mobile Robots and AGVs

Roboteon has introduced a unified management platform designed to optimize automated material flows and boost productivity for autonomous mobile robots (AMRs) and AGVs in factory environments.

Technology provider Roboteon has officially announced the launch of its unified management and orchestration software platform, specifically designed for autonomous mobile robots (AMRs) and automated guided vehicles (AGVs) in industrial manufacturing environments. This breakthrough solution aims to comprehensively optimize automated material handling flows, while empowering enterprises with enhanced visibility, control, and significant improvements in overall shop-floor operational productivity.

Key Developments

According to a report by 'RoboticsTomorrow', Roboteon's new solution is designed to address one of the greatest challenges facing today's smart factories: the fragmentation of autonomous fleet management. Previously, businesses often had to employ multiple separate software systems for different robot brands, making data synchronization highly complex. The arrival of Roboteon's orchestration solution allows the integration of all AMR and AGV devices into a single management interface. This consolidation not only minimizes operational conflicts but also enables managers to allocate resources optimally and dynamically in real time. The system continuously tracks the location, battery status, and performance metrics of each robot throughout the shift.

Technical & Technological Analysis

At the core of Roboteon's technology is a 'smart orchestration architecture' capable of automatically handling complex material distribution scenarios. The platform acts as a centralized control brain, connecting directly with Enterprise Resource Planning (ERP) and Manufacturing Execution Systems (MES). Consequently, data flows seamlessly from production order placement to the physical transportation of materials by the robots. The system utilizes advanced routing algorithms to automatically calculate the most optimal path for each robot, proactively preventing traffic congestion at narrow shop-floor intersections. Robust compatibility with various industrial communication protocols allows this solution to be easily deployed on existing hardware infrastructures without requiring major upgrade costs.

Expert Opinions & Insights

Many automation industry experts agree that transitioning from individual device management to holistic system orchestration is an inevitable evolution. Representatives from market research organizations indicate that the long-standing lack of a unified connectivity standard among mobile robot manufacturers has been a major barrier, causing enterprises to hesitate in scaling their automation. Roboteon's centralized management tool is expected to resolve this bottleneck, providing a more comprehensive view of Overall Equipment Effectiveness (OEE). However, observers also note that the software's real-world effectiveness will heavily depend on the stability of the wireless network infrastructure (such as private Wi-Fi or local 5G) at customer manufacturing facilities.
